About this role

ROLE

SUMMARY: Drives the practical application of large language models (LLMs) and agentic artificial intelligence (AI) across the Inflammation & Immunology (I&I) portfolio by partnering closely with clinical and scientific teams to identify high-value use cases, building reusable workflows, and ensure adoption, rigor, and impact. This role sits within AI Delivery & Enablement (AIDE), the Systems Immunology line created to make AI and omics workflows practical across I&I through the conversion of repeat asks into reusable capabilities embedded in day-to-day scientific work. The role sits at the intersection of clinical sciences and applied AI. The strongest candidate will have the clinical development experience to recognize where work can accelerate - study design, feasibility, trial conduct, clinical data review, and regulatory readiness – and clinic-omics fluency to connect those workflows to biomarker strategy, endpoint development, patient stratification, and high-dimensional data from clinical and translational studies. Near-term, the emphasis is clinical execution, where repetitive, document- and data-heavy work offers the fastest gains. Over time, the greater differentiation will come from extending those workflows into clinical omics analysis. The ideal candidate can operate across both domains, while bringing clear depth in at least one. Above all, this is a hands-on practitioner role focused on building and applying reusable AI workflows, not an AI governance or program-management role.

ROLE

RESPONSIBILITIES: Identify high-value, repeat use cases across I&I clinical development and translational science where LLMs, agentic AI, and workflow automation can materially improve the speed, quality, and accessibility of the work; then design, build, and refine the reusable AI tools that address them. Work directly with clinical scientists, clinical operations, biostatistics, translational teams, and computational biologists to understand real workflow pain points, define fit-for-purpose solutions, and iterate quickly toward tools that are scientifically useful and operationally adopted. Work across the Digital ecosystem to prevent duplication and deploy existing platforms where appropriate, bringing the scientific requirements and evaluation criteria that make build-or-buy decisions defensible. Apply the same rigor to AI that you would to any clinical or scientific method: fit-for-purpose evaluation, grounded outputs, documentation, guardrails, disclosure of model limitations, and human oversight where it matters, with particular care where workflows touch GCP-governed or otherwise regulated data. In the near term, concentrate on clinical execution, where study design, feasibility, data review, and submission readiness offer the fastest and most visible gains; over time, extend the same approach to clinical omics and translational data, where the capability is harder to build and holds its value longer. Throughout, raise AI fluency among collaborators by demonstrating practical workflows, explaining trade-offs clearly, and helping scientists build confidence in the responsible use of LLM-enabled tools.

BASIC QUALIFICATIONS

PhD with 1+ years of experience OR Master’s degree and 5+ years of experience, OR Bachelor’s degree and 6+ years of experience. Advanced degree in a clinical, life-science, computational-biology, or related quantitative field preferred. Direct experience supporting clinical development, clinical science, clinical operations, clinical data review, or regulatory science, with a strong working understanding of GCP, clinical trial conduct, and the drug development process. Experience with omics or other high-dimensional data from clinical or translational studies - biomarker and endpoint work, patient stratification, or exploratory and mechanistic analysis - and with translating those results into development decisions.
